Ruths walks explore woodlands, meadows, and coastal paths, sharing herbal wisdom, ethics, identification, and tastings. We learn about the science and energetics of the cleansing native plant medicines of Spring.
The new growth of springs fresh greens in bountiful. This early harvest is a time for purification, cleansing and renewal. We may discuss medicinal flowers, leafs, barks, fruits, fungi, roots etc- depending on what’s available.
This walk will take place from Newlyn Green, meeting beside the Newlyn Art Gallery at 10.30am. The walk will last between 1.5 – 2 hours and we will finish where we start.
